WKYR-FM
WKYR-FM (107.9 FM) is a radio station broadcasting a country music format. Licensed to Burkesville, Kentucky, United States, the station is currently owned by Connie Crabtree through licensee River Country Communications, LLC, and features programming from ABC Radio and Jones Radio Network.[1]

History
The station went on the air as WKYI-FM, on 18 February 1988. On 16 March 1988, it changed its call sign to the current WKYR-FM.[2]
